一种路径确定方法、终端和通信系统技术方案

技术编号:38759749 阅读:12 留言:0更新日期:2023-09-10 09:44
本公开提出了一种路径确定方法、终端和通信系统,涉及通信技术领域。其中,路径确定方法由第一终端执行,包括:从第二终端接收第一发现请求消息;根据源终端的信息和目标终端的信息,判断是否已存储源终端至目标终端的路径中第一终端的上一跳节点的信息;在未存储源终端至目标终端的路径中第一终端的上一跳节点的信息的情况下,根据第一发现请求消息确定并存储源终端至目标终端的路径中第一终端的上一跳节点的信息;以及向第三终端发送第二发现请求消息。通过以上方法,能够高效、可靠地建立两个终端通过单个或多个中继终端进行通信的通信路径。信路径。信路径。

【技术实现步骤摘要】
一种路径确定方法、终端和通信系统


[0001]本公开涉及通信
,特别涉及一种路径确定方法、终端和通信系统。

技术介绍

[0002]在第三代合作伙伴计划(3rd generation partnership project,3GPP)标准中,两个支持邻近服务(Proximity Service,ProSe)的终端(User Equipment,UE)可以通过侧行链路(Sidelink,或者说PC5接口)建立直接通信连接。并且,在3GPP标准中,也支持两个终端之间通过中继终端(Relay UE)实现基于侧行链路的通信连接,以及,支持一个终端通过中继终端连接到移动网络。这样可以扩大网络的覆盖范围,降低对网络的投资。
[0003]在网络内可能存在多个具备中继能力的终端。当两个支持临近服务的终端需要进行通信时,可以通过建立通过至少一个中继终端的多跳通信路径来实现通信。通过建立多跳通信路径,可以实现通信服务的深度覆盖,减少对无线基站部署的依赖,降低网络部署成本。

技术实现思路

[0004]本公开提供了一种路径确定方法、终端和通信系统。
[0005]根据本公开的第一方面,提出了一种路径确定方法,由第一终端执行,包括:从第二终端接收第一发现请求消息,所述第一发现请求消息包括源终端的信息和目标终端的信息,所述第一终端为中继终端,所述第二终端为源终端或中继终端;根据所述源终端的信息和所述目标终端的信息,判断是否已存储所述源终端至所述目标终端的路径中所述第一终端的上一跳节点的信息;在未存储所述源终端至所述目标终端的路径中所述第一终端的上一跳节点的信息的情况下,根据所述第一发现请求消息确定并存储所述源终端至所述目标终端的路径中所述第一终端的上一跳节点的信息;以及向第三终端发送第二发现请求消息,所述第二发现请求消息包括源终端的信息、第一终端的信息和目标终端的信息,用于辅助所述第三终端确定所述源终端至所述目标终端的路径中所述第三终端的上一跳节点的信息,所述第三终端为所述目标终端或中继终端。
[0006]在一些实施例中,路径确定方法还包括:在已存储所述源终端至所述目标终端的路径中所述第一终端的上一跳节点的信息的情况下,丢弃所述第一发现请求消息。
[0007]在一些实施例中,路径确定方法还包括:在第一时长内接收到第一发现响应消息的情况下,根据所述第一发现响应消息确定并存储所述源终端至所述目标终端的路径中所述第一终端的下一跳节点的信息,所述第一发现响应消息包括源终端的信息和目标终端的信息,所述第一时长为从确定所述源终端至所述目标终端的路径中所述第一终端的上一跳节点的信息后开始计时;以及向所述源终端至所述目标终端的路径中所述第一终端的上一跳节点发送第二发现响应消息,所述第二发现响应消息包括源终端支持的中继服务码和第二跳数中的至少一项、源终端的信息、第一终端的信息和目标终端的信息,所述第二跳数为所述源终端至所述目标终端的路径的总跳数。
[0008]在一些实施例中,路径确定方法还包括:在第一时长内未接收到第一发现响应消息的情况下,删除所述源终端至所述目标终端的路径中所述第一终端的上一跳节点的信息。
[0009]在一些实施例中,路径确定方法还包括:在第二时长内接收到第一路径建立请求的情况下,建立与所述第一终端的上一跳节点的直连通信路径,其中,所述第二时长为从确定所述源终端至所述目标终端的路径中所述第一终端的上一跳节点的信息、以及所述源终端至所述目标终端的路径中所述第一终端的下一跳节点的信息后开始计时;以及向所述第一终端的下一跳节点发送第二路径建立请求。
[0010]在一些实施例中,路径确定方法还包括:在第二时长内未从所述第一终端的上一跳节点接收到第一路径建立请求的情况下,删除所述源终端至所述目标终端的路径中所述第一终端的上一跳节点的信息、以及所述源终端至所述目标终端的路径中所述第一终端的下一跳节点的信息。
[0011]在一些实施例中,所述第一发现请求消息还包括所述源终端支持的中继服务码和第一跳数中的至少一项,以及,在所述第二终端为中继终端的情况下,所述第一发现请求消息还包括第二终端的信息,所述第一跳数为从所述源终端开始累计的跳数,所述第二终端的信息包括第二终端的标识和第二终端进行直连通信所用的层二链路标识。
[0012]在一些实施例中,所述根据所述第一发现请求消息确定并存储所述源终端至所述目标终端的路径中的上一跳节点的信息包括:根据接收到所述第一发现请求消息的时间、所述第一跳数、所述第一发现请求消息的信号强度和多跳累计信号强度中的至少一项,确定并存储所述源终端至所述目标终端的路径中所述第一终端的上一跳节点的信息。
[0013]在一些实施例中,所述第一发现请求消息中源终端的信息包括所述源终端的标识和所述源终端进行直连通信所用的层二链路标识中的至少一项,所述第一发现请求消息中的目标终端的信息包括目标终端的标识或者目标终端需要支持的能力标识。
[0014]在一些实施例中,所述第一发现响应消息还包括源终端支持的中继服务码和第二跳数中的至少一项,所述第二跳数为所述源终端至所述目标终端的路径的总跳数。
[0015]在一些实施例中,所述第一发现响应消息中的源终端的信息包括源终端的标识,所述第一发现响应消息中的目标终端的信息包括目标终端的标识和目标终端进行直连通信所用的层二链路标识。
[0016]根据本公开的第二方面,提出了一种路径确定方法,由第三终端执行,包括:从第一终端接收第二发现请求消息,所述第二发现请求消息包括源终端的信息、第一终端的信息和目标终端的信息,所述第一终端为中继终端;在确定自身为所述目标终端的情况下,根据所述第二发现请求消息,判断是否将包含所述第一终端的路径作为所述源终端至所述目标终端的路径;在确定将包含所述第一终端的路径作为所述源终端至所述目标终端的路径的情况下,向所述第一终端发送第一发现响应消息,所述第一发现响应消息用于辅助所述第一终端确定所述源终端至所述目标终端的路径中所述第一终端的下一跳节点的信息。
[0017]在一些实施例中,根据所述第二发现请求消息,判断是否将包含所述第一终端的路径作为所述源终端至所述目标终端的路径包括:根据源终端的信息和目标终端的信息,判断是否已存储所述源终端至所述目标终端的路径信息;在未存储所述源终端至所述目标终端的路径信息的情况下,根据所述第二发现请求消息确定是否将包含所述第一终端的路
径作为所述源终端至所述目标终端的路径。
[0018]在一些实施例中,根据所述第二发现请求消息,判断是否将包含所述第一终端的路径作为所述源终端至所述目标终端的路径还包括:在已存储所述源终端至所述目标终端的路径信息的情况下,丢弃所述第二发现请求消息。
[0019]在一些实施例中,路径确定方法还包括:在第三时长内从所述第一终端接收到第二路径建立请求的情况下,建立与所述第一终端的直连通信路径,所述第三时长为从所述第三终端确定所述源终端至所述目标终端的路径信息后开始计时。
[0020]在一些实施例中,路径确定方法还包本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种路径确定方法,由第一终端执行,包括:从第二终端接收第一发现请求消息,所述第一发现请求消息包括源终端的信息和目标终端的信息,所述第一终端为中继终端,所述第二终端为源终端或中继终端;根据所述源终端的信息和所述目标终端的信息,判断是否已存储所述源终端至所述目标终端的路径中所述第一终端的上一跳节点的信息;在未存储所述源终端至所述目标终端的路径中所述第一终端的上一跳节点的信息的情况下,根据所述第一发现请求消息确定并存储所述源终端至所述目标终端的路径中所述第一终端的上一跳节点的信息;以及向第三终端发送第二发现请求消息,所述第二发现请求消息包括源终端的信息、第一终端的信息和目标终端的信息,用于辅助所述第三终端确定所述源终端至所述目标终端的路径中所述第三终端的上一跳节点的信息,所述第三终端为所述目标终端或中继终端。2.根据权利要求1所述的路径确定方法,还包括:在已存储所述源终端至所述目标终端的路径中所述第一终端的上一跳节点的信息的情况下,丢弃所述第一发现请求消息。3.根据权利要求1所述的路径确定方法,还包括:在第一时长内接收到第一发现响应消息的情况下,根据所述第一发现响应消息确定并存储所述源终端至所述目标终端的路径中所述第一终端的下一跳节点的信息,所述第一发现响应消息包括源终端的信息和目标终端的信息,所述第一时长为从确定所述源终端至所述目标终端的路径中所述第一终端的上一跳节点的信息后开始计时;以及向所述源终端至所述目标终端的路径中所述第一终端的上一跳节点发送第二发现响应消息,所述第二发现响应消息包括源终端支持的中继服务码和第二跳数中的至少一项、源终端的信息、第一终端的信息和目标终端的信息,所述第二跳数为所述源终端至所述目标终端的路径的总跳数。4.根据权利要求3所述的路径确定方法,还包括:在第一时长内未接收到第一发现响应消息的情况下,删除所述源终端至所述目标终端的路径中所述第一终端的上一跳节点的信息。5.根据权利要求3所述的路径确定方法,还包括:在第二时长内从所述第一终端的上一跳节点接收到第一路径建立请求的情况下,建立与所述第一终端的上一跳节点的直连通信路径,其中,所述第二时长为从确定所述源终端至所述目标终端的路径中所述第一终端的上一跳节点的信息、以及所述源终端至所述目标终端的路径中所述第一终端的下一跳节点的信息后开始计时;以及向所述第一终端的下一跳节点发送第二路径建立请求。6.根据权利要求5所述的路径确定方法,还包括:在第二时长内未从所述第一终端的上一跳节点接收到第一路径建立请求的情况下,删除所述源终端至所述目标终端的路径中所述第一终端的上一跳节点的信息、以及所述源终端至所述目标终端的路径中所述第一终端的下一跳节点的信息。7.根据权利要求1所述的路径确定方法,其中,所述第一发现请求消息还包括所述源终端支持的中继服务码和第一跳数中的至少一项,以及,在所述第二终端为中继终端的情况下,所述第一发现请求消息还包括第二终端的信息,所述第一跳数为从所述源终端开始累
计的跳数,所述第二终端的信息包括第二终端的标识和第二终端进行直连通信所用的层二链路标识中的至少一项。8.根据权利要求7所述的路径确定方法,所述根据所述第一发现请求消息确定并存储所述源终端至所述目标终端的路径中的上一跳节点的信息包括:根据接收到所述第一发现请求消息的时间、所述第一跳数、所述第一发现请求消息的信号强度和多跳累计信号强度中的至少一项,确定并存储所述源终端至所述目标终端的路径中所述第一终端的上一跳节点的信息。9.根据权利要求1所述的路径确定方法,其中,所述第一发现请求消息中的源终端的信息包括所述源终端的标识和所述源终端进行直连通信所用的层二链路标识中的至少一项,所述第一发现请求消息中的目标终端的信息包括目标终端的标识或者目标终端需要支持的能力标识。10.根据权利要求3所述的路径确定方法,其中,所述第一发现响应消息还包括源终端支持的中继服务码和第二跳数中的至少一项,所述第二跳数为所述源终端至所述目标终端的路径的总跳数。11.根据权利要求3所述的路径确定方法,其中,所述第一发现响应消息中的源终端的信息包括源终端的标识,所述第一发现响应消息中的目标终端的信息包括目标终端的标识和目标终端进行直连通信所用的层二链路标识。12.一种路径确定方法,由第三终端执行,包括:从第一终端接收第二发现请求消息,所述第二发现请求消息包括源终端的信息、第一终端的信息和目标终端的信息,所述第一终端为中继终端;在确定自身为所述目标终端的情况下,根据所述第二发现请求消息,判断是否将包含所述第一终端的路径作为所述源终端至所述目标终端的路径;在确定将包含所述第一终端的路径作为所述源终端至所述目标终端的路径的情况下,向所述第一终端发送第一发现响应消息,所述第一发现响应消息用于辅助所述第一终端确定所述源终端至所述目标终端的路径中所述第一终端的下一跳节点的信息。13.根据权利要求12所述的路径确定方法,其中,所述根据所述第二发现请求消息,判断是否将包含所述第一终端的路径作为所述源终端至所述目标终端的路径包括:根据源终端的信息和目标终端的信息,判断是否已存储所述源终端至所述目标终端的路径信息;在未存储所述源终端至所述目标终端的路径信息的情况下,根据所述第二发现请求消息确定是否将包含所述第一终端的路径作为所述源终端至所述目标终端的路径。14.根据权利要求13所述的路径确定方法,其中,所述根据所述第二发现请求消息,判断是否将包含所述第一终端的路径作为所述源终端至所述目标终端的路径还包括:在已存储所述源终端至所述目标终端的路径信息的情况下,丢弃所述第二发现请求消息。15.根据权利要求12所述的路径确定方法,还包括:在第三时长内从所述第一终端接收到第二路径建立请求的情况下,建立与所述第一终端的直连通信路径,所述第三时长为从所述第三终端确定所述源终端至所述目标终端的...

【专利技术属性】
技术研发人员:聂衡贾靖邢燕霞毕奇
申请(专利权)人:中国电信股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1